WebTons to BTU/hr conversion formula. One refrigeration ton is equal to 12000 BTUs per hour: 1 RT = 12000 BTU/hr. One BTU per hour is equal to 8.33333×10-5 refrigeration ton: 1 BTU/hr = 8.33333×10-5 RT . Since each pound of water converted to ice takes 144 BTU, the formula is 2,000 X 144 = 288,000 BTU. Therefore 1 ton of cooling is equal to 288,000 BTU/Day or 12,000 BTU/Hr. or 200 BTU/Min. or, if you like, 105,120,000 BTU/Yr. WebCooling Tower Tons. A cooling tower ton is defined as: 1 cooling tower ton = 1 TONS evap = 1 TONS cond x 1.25 = 15000 Btu/h = 3782 k Calories/h = 15826 kJ/h = 4.396 kW.
